氢化物发生-原子荧光光谱法测定化妆品中的铅

摘    要:本文介绍了氢化物发生-原子荧光光谱法对化妆品中铅含量的定量分析方法,并研究拟定了原子荧光光谱法测定铅的分析条件,本方法回收率为96.0%-101.5%,检出限为0.18ng/mL,精密度(RSD)为0.90%-0.94%,准确性好,可用于测定化妆品中铅的含量。

Determination of the Content of Lead in Cosmetics by Hydrogenation Combined with Atomic Fluorescent Spectrum

Abstract:A new quantitative analytic method for determination lead in cosmetics by hydrogenation combined with atomic fluorescent spectrum has been developed.The optimum conditions of atomic fluorescent spectrum was studied.This method has some characteristics such as low detection limit and high precision as well as good accuracy,and can be applied to determine the lead content in cosmetics with satisfactory results.
